Solana ShredStream для Node.js (TypeScript): преодоление технических ограничений потоковой передачи данных

Solana ShredStream для Node.js (TypeScript): преодоление технических ограничений потоковой передачи данных

2025.06.26
ELSOUL LABO B.V. (штаб-квартира: Амстердам, Нидерланды; генеральный директор: Fumitake Kawasaki) и Validators DAO объявили о новом решении, которое устраняет технические ограничения при потоковой передаче Solana Shreds и выводит обработку потоковых данных в среде Node.js (TypeScript) на новый уровень. До настоящего момента среда Node.js не справлялась с высоконагруженной потоковой передачей данных Solana ShredStream, что приводило к задержкам и сбоям системы. Особенно остро эта проблема проявлялась при работе с ShredStream data без фильтров, когда клиенты Node.js нередко сталкивались с остановкой обработки и отказом системы. Теперь Validators DAO преодолела эти технические ограничения и представила новое решение, которое позволяет эффективно и стабильно обрабатывать большие объемы данных Solana ShredStream в среде Node.js. Эта технология делает возможной обработку потоковых данных Solana Shreds в Node.js, что ранее считалось практически недостижимым.

Solana Shreds Client: высокоскоростная и масштабируемая потоковая передача данных

Solana Shreds Client был разработан для решения проблем производительности, с которыми сталкивались традиционные клиенты Node.js. Используя Rust и NAPI (Node-API), это решение максимально раскрывает потенциал асинхронной и параллельной обработки для эффективной работы с потоками данных большого объема. В результате данные Solana ShredStream теперь можно обрабатывать с низкой задержкой даже без фильтров, снимая прежние ограничения.

Рост производительности благодаря Rust и NAPI

Интеграция Rust и NAPI позволила радикально повысить производительность Node.js. Это решение выводит среду Node.js за пределы традиционных ограничений однопоточной обработки и обеспечивает быструю и стабильную обработку потоковых данных.
  • Высокая производительность: интеграция Rust с NAPI существенно повышает производительность и обеспечивает стабильную обработку больших объемов данных Solana Shreds.
  • Бесшовная интеграция: NAPI позволяет эффективно связать Node.js с Rust, обеспечивая плавную обработку потоковых данных без дополнительных настроек и вспомогательных инструментов.
  • Эффективное использование памяти: решение обеспечивает высокую эффективность работы с памятью, снижает потребление ресурсов и одновременно поддерживает быструю обработку данных. Подробнее см. в официальной документации Node-API - Node.js: Node-API

Интеграция в Solana Stream SDK v0.10.0

Solana Stream SDK Этот технологический прорыв полностью интегрирован в Solana Stream SDK v0.10.0. Благодаря новому SDK разработчики теперь могут легко использовать потоки данных Solana Shreds в среде Node.js и добиваться высокопроизводительной обработки данных с минимальными усилиями.

Оцените технологическое новшество с бесплатным пробным доступом к ShredStream

ERPC Direct Shreds Validators DAO предоставляет бесплатный 1-дневный пробный доступ, чтобы можно было оценить высокоскоростную потоковую обработку, реализованную в Solana Shreds Client. Эта инновационная технология позволяет использовать потоки данных Solana эффективнее, чем когда-либо прежде.

Дальнейшее развитие

Validators DAO продолжит разрабатывать инструменты и библиотеки для дальнейшего укрепления экосистемы Solana и развития технологий потоковой передачи данных Solana. Следите за будущими обновлениями.